The Game Developers Choice Awards 2026 are set to take place on March 12, and Clair Obscur Expedition 33 has scored a near-clean sweep, earning eight nominations across nine total categories. One of the industry’s most prestigious annual events, the Game Developers Choice Awards are voted on by members of the GCDA’s International Choice Awards Network, which is an “invitation-only group comprised of leading game creators from all parts of the video game industry”.
Game Developers Choice Awards 2026 nominations
Below are the full Game Developers Choice Awards 2026 nominations, via GamesIndustry.biz:
Game of the Year
- Blue Prince (Dogubomb/Raw Fury)
- Clair Obscur Expedition 33 (Sandfall Interactive/Kepler Interactive)
- Donkey Kong Bananza (Nintendo EPD/Nintendo)
- Ghost of Yōtei (Sucker Punch Productions/Sony Interactive Entertainment)
- Hollow Knight Silksong (Team Cherry)
- Split Fiction (Hazelight Studios/Electronic Arts)
Best Debut
- Ball x Pit (Kenny Sun & Friends/Devolver Digital)
- Blue Prince
- Clair Obscur Expedition 33
- Dispatch (Adhoc Studio)
Best Narrative
- Clair Obscur Expedition 33
- Despelote (Julián Cordero, Sebastián Valbuena/Panic)
- Dispatch
- Ghost of Yōtei
- Split Fiction
Best Design
- Ball x Pit
- Blue Prince
- Clair Obscur Expedition 33
- Donkey Kong Bananza
- Split Fiction
Best Visual Art
- Absolum (Guard Crush Games, Dotemu, Supamonks/Dotemu)
- Clair Obscur Expedition 33
- Death Stranding 2 On the Beach
- Ghost of Yōtei
- Hades 2 (Supergiant Games)
- Keeper (Double Fine Productions/Xbox Game Studios)
Best Audio
- Clair Obscur Expedition 33
- Death Stranding 2 On the Beach (Kojima Productions/SIE)
- Ghost of Yōtei
- Rift of the NecroDancer (Brace Yourself Games, Tic Toc Games/Kei Publishing)
- South of Midnight (Compulsion Games/Xbox Game Studios)
Best Technology
- Clair Obscur Expedition 33
- Death Stranding 2 On the Beach
- Donkey Kong Bananza
- Ghost of Yōtei
- Split Fiction
Innovation Award
- Ball x Pit
- Baby Steps (Gabe Cuzzillo, Maxi Boch, Bennett Foddy/Devolver Digital)
- Blue Prince
- Clair Obscur Expedition 33
- Donkey Kong Bananza
Social Impact Award
- And Roger (TearyHand Studio/Kodansha)
- Consume Me (Jenny Jiao Hsia/AP Thomson/Jie En Lee/Violet W-P/Ken “coda” Snyder/Hexecutable)
- Despelote
- Dispatch
Clair Obscur Expedition 33 leads the nominations with eight nods across nine categories. Ghost of Yōtei follows in second place with five nominations, while Donkey Kong Bananza ranks third with four.
Expedition 33 already made history by earning the most nominations ever at Geoff Keighley’s The Game Awards, surpassing The Last of Us Part 2’s previous record of 11 nominations with a total of 13.
Clair Obscur Expedition 33 surpasses 400 Game of the Year wins
As tallied by ResetEra member Angie, Clair Obscur Expedition 33 has currently earned 420 Game of the Year wins. This puts the game within striking distance of breaking Elden Ring’s all-time record of 435 GOTY awards.
In addition to its Game of the Year nomination at the Game Developers Choice Awards 2026, Expedition 33 is nominated for GOTY at the DICE Awards 2026 and has been included on the BAFTA Game Awards 2026 Game of the Year longlist.
Coming close to Elden Ring’s record is a remarkable achievement few could have predicted, including developer Sandfall Interactive. Among industry peers, the Final Fantasy 7 Rebirth director has named Expedition 33 his Game of the Year, revealing at a joint fan event that it left him “deeply inspired”.
While all of Expedition 33’s Game of the Year awards are well-deserved, Sandfall Interactive has acknowledged the pressure it mounts on the studio’s next project. Although aware of the pressure, the developer has assured fans that it won’t affect the studio’s ethos of doing what they want rather than trying to please everyone.
